Dining alone in New York City transforms from a daunting task into a curated experience through a selection of establishments that prioritize comfort, intimacy, and high-quality service for the individual patron. Whether seeking the bustling energy of a counter-seat or a quiet corner for reflection, these spots cater to those who find joy in their own company alongside exceptional cuisine. Among the standout recommendations is Muku, a Japanese gem in Greenwich Village that offers a cozy, welcoming atmosphere perfect for solo visitors looking to savor refined flavors without the pressure of a large group setting. From upscale bistros to hidden neighborhood favorites, the city's culinary landscape ensures that eating solo is not just convenient, but a celebrated way to explore the diverse tastes of the Five Boroughs.
